Price reflects Passport America 50% discount. Also saved 4% by paying with cash. Passport America is valid Valid for three days - even weekends.

This park is located on what I believe is a working farm. The park and the working farm were immaculate. Each site had a gravel area and a cement pad with picnic table. All sites are full hook-ups.

For an RV park, there was ample space between the sites. Our site was on the back corner with lots of privacy.

Has an nice onsite laundry. $1.50 to was and $1.50 to dry. Heard rumor that there was a hot tub or pool but did not find it.

Not much to do here but be sure to check out Heavys BBQ in town.

Our first ever wind energy laundry experience. Worked great but a tiny bit noisy. Also, our first ever RV park without a bath/showerhouse. Yeah, that's odd to me. The price paid includes a Good Sam 10% discount. Also odd that credit cards pay a higher rate. Our stay was in Feb 2018 and the North winds blew the Hondo train noise into camp. It was very noticeable to us but should not be a bother most of the year.The park was very well laid out and neat and clean as any I've seen. All utilities including wireless fidelity were perfect. The gardener deserves a raise. We felt very safe and secure. The owners and family seem to care and it shows. When he gave me a golf cart tour to choose a site I was shocked that there was no bathhouse. He realized that it was not disclosed in our phone conversations and kindly comped me a second night. An easy 5 star park if it had showers but a strong 4 stars without. The old school Raye Theater in Hondo was a hoot. The ticket booth was on the sidewalk out front and they even had a big red curtain that was pulled back when the movie started. We loved it.

We only had one night but this park was nice enough to stay much longer. The sites are full hook up with a mix of back in and pull through. Bring a few levelers as the sites are made up of fine gravel and slightly sloped for drainage. However they are spacious with plenty of room for slides, most have concrete pads with a picnic table, and a few even have fire pits.

This RV Park is laid out very nicely with back in sites mostly accommodating full timers, and pull throughs for overnighters. Don't let the idea of full timers or long term guests deter you. The management does not allow any garbage or trashy mess left out. The park is clean and well maintained.

Security gates close at night and require a code to enter. There is a laundry room for guests to use and propane filling on site.

Our router and AT&T phones had full bars on LTE. We were able to stream without any issues. The price reflects a 50% discount with Passport America. We also paid cash to save a small fee for credit card usage.

The only downside is if you are a light sleeper you can hear train horns in the distance throughout the night. We ran our dehumidifier to help with the sound and they didn't bother us.
